Delhi’s IGIA to build dedicated terminal for private jets
06 Aug 2009
Delhi's Indira Gandhi International Airport (IGIA) will construct a terminal dedicated to chartered flights and private jets over a period of two years.
The facility would satisfy the airport's need to have separate terminals for business passengers.
Delhi International Airport Ltd (DIAL) has requested an express of interest from international fixed-base operators to construct and run dedicated general aviation facilities at the airport.
The terminal will include conference facilities, special lounges, hotel reservations and catering.
